  • Overview

    Before the era of mass media advertising, business people got their points across by means of a rich variety of engraved announcements. These cleverly drawn illustrations — with areas left blank for inserting messages — are as popular with graphic designers today as they were generations ago. For this treasury of antique attention-getters, the author has selected 295 royalty-free mortised cuts from the 19th-century publications. Included are an impressive array of banners and scrolls, signboards, street vendors, dapper gentlemen and demure damsels, wagons, railroad cars, hot-air balloons, animals, dancers, barrels, books, bouquets, and more. Commercial artists and designers will find this inexpensive collection an ideal way to add antique charm to advertisements and many other graphic projects.
